Our first stop is Mission BBQ. This is a place that I eat often because I don’t have to think too hard about how I will eat keto. Mission BBQ gets a gold star for taste, having their nutritional information fully listed on their website, using low carb rubs, and not covering everything in sugary sauces. Their meats are also priced a la carte so, if I don’t want a vegetable, I don’t have to pay for one. Mission BBQ also does a phenomenal job of supporting public safety and the military in my community.
A meal that I get often is (macros edited 09/25/2018):
- Half a Yard Bird (613 cal, 85g protein, 30g fat, 0.8g total carbs, 0.3g net carbs)
- 4 oz of cheddar jalapeno sausage (319 cal, 16g protein, 27.5g fat, 1.5g total carbs, 1.0g net carbs)
- 1 oz of the Alabama White Sauce (161 cal, 0.8g protein, 3g fat, 1g total carbs, 0.5g net carbs)
Macro totals for this meal: 1093 cal, 101.8g protein, 60.5g fat, 3.3g total carbs, 1.8g net carbs)
This is a huge meal so I will eat lighter the rest of the day to make up for it, but it is so yummy! If you have a Mission BBQ in your area, I highly recommend it.
